Is You Is or Is You Ain't My REGA? Rega currently does not make a 3 speed turntable. They do however produce a dedicated 78rpm turntable called the REGA 78. In the UK this retails for £224 (approx $336) without cartridge. They also sell a 78 cartridge which retails for £42 (approx ... | |
White cloudy film on inside groove of an LP Another possibility is that it could be related to the amount of styrene used in the raw material mix? As Mgottlieb mentions this is common on used lp's where there is visible groove wear and the groove starts to turn white. Regards, Richard. | |

To much power into one recepticle? I think you mean 115 VOLTS on the display..? The 5000 has a continuous rating of 1,850 watts so total up the maximum wattage rating from the data plates on the equipment you have connected and double check what your requirement is. Regards, Richard. | |
